The brain tumor treatment cost in India varies significantly depending on factors such as the type of hospital (public vs. private), location, complexity of the surgery, doctor’s expertise, and post-operative care requirements. Here’s a city-wise breakdown:
| City | Brain Tumor Surgery Cost (INR) | International Cost (USD) |
| Brain tumor surgery cost in Delhi | ₹5,50,000 – ₹12,00,000 | $8,250 – $18,000 |
| Brain tumor surgery cost in Noida | ₹5,50,000 – ₹11,00,000 | $8,250 – $16,500 |
| Brain tumor surgery cost in Gurgaon | ₹6,00,000 – ₹12,00,000 | $9,000 – $18,000 |
| Brain tumor surgery cost in Mumbai | ₹6,00,000 – ₹15,00,000 | $9,000 – $22,500 |
| Brain tumor surgery cost in Bangalore | ₹5,00,000 – ₹13,00,000 | $7,500 – $19,500 |
| Brain tumor surgery cost in Chennai | ₹4,50,000 – ₹12,50,000 | $6,750 – $18,750 |
| Brain tumor surgery cost in Hyderabad | ₹5,20,000 – ₹13,00,000 | $7,800 – $19,500 |
| Brain tumor surgery cost in Ahmedabad | ₹4,00,000 – ₹10,00,000 | $6,000 – $15,000 |
| Brain tumor surgery cost in Kolkata | ₹4,20,000 – ₹9,50,000 | $6,300 – $14,250 |
| Brain tumor surgery cost in Cochin | ₹4,00,000 – ₹8,50,000 | $6,000 – $12,750 |
For international patients, the brain tumor operation cost is usually higher due to additional services like accommodation, travel assistance, visa handling, and language support.

| Patient Type | Insurance Type | Coverage Scope | Notable Providers/Programs |
| Domestic (India) | Government Schemes | Covers partial to full cost of treatment in empaneled hospitals | Ayushman Bharat, CGHS, ESI, State Govt Health Schemes |
| Private Health Insurance | Comprehensive coverage incl. diagnostics, surgery, therapy, hospital stay | Star Health, HDFC ERGO, ICICI Lombard, Niva Bupa | |
| Employer-based Insurance | Corporate policies with tie-ups for cashless neuro-oncology care | MediAssist, Raksha TPA, Aditya Birla Group Plans | |
| International | Travel Health Insurance | Emergency care + selected diagnostics or surgeries (may need reimbursement) | IMG Global, Cigna Global, Allianz Travel Insurance |
| Embassy/Consular Tie-ups | Govt. or embassy-supported care via MoUs with Indian hospitals | Nigeria, Bangladesh, Middle East embassies, African nations | |
| Direct Insurance Billing | Some hospitals have tie-ups with global insurance for cashless treatment | Max, Apollo, Fortis (tie-ups with Aetna, BUPA, etc.) |

Common investigations include MRI scans, CT scans, PET scans, biopsies, and molecular diagnostic tests to detect specific genetic mutations.
An MRI or CT scan typically costs between ₹5,000 and ₹30,000 ($70 – $400), depending on the complexity and hospital.
Molecular tests may include genetic mutation tests like EGFR, BRAF, MGMT, and IDH1. These tests help in tailoring personalized treatments.
Conventional treatments include surgery, radiation therapy, and chemotherapy. The cost ranges from ₹50,000 to ₹6,00,000 ($650 – $8,000).
Molecular therapies such as targeted therapy and immunotherapy can range from ₹3,00,000 to ₹18,00,000 ($4,000 – $23,000).
Yes, rehabilitation including physiotherapy, occupational therapy, and speech therapy is often required for recovery. The cost of rehabilitation can range from ₹500 to ₹2,500 ($6 – $30) per session.
Treatment costs for international patients are typically higher due to additional services like travel assistance, language translation, and visa support.
Physiotherapy can cost anywhere between ₹500 and ₹2,500 per session ($6 – $30), depending on the clinic and treatment required.
Possible complications include surgical infections, neurological deficits, blood clots, and issues from radiation therapy. Managing these complications can cost anywhere from ₹50,000 to ₹2,00,000 ($650 – $2,600).
A full treatment package, including surgery, chemotherapy, and radiation, can cost between ₹10,00,000 to ₹35,00,000 ($13,000 – $45,000) depending on the patient’s condition and treatment plan.
Consider the hospital’s reputation, medical technology, specialist experience, patient support services, and cost. It’s also important to check for accreditation and reviews from previous patients.
Yes, international patients often bring family members with them. Indian hospitals provide accommodation and visa assistance for family members as well.
The duration of stay varies. For surgery, you may need 1-2 weeks, while a combined treatment package may require a stay of 4-6 weeks.
Yes, there are several government hospitals like AIIMS (Delhi), PGIMER (Chandigarh), and NIMHANS (Bangalore) that provide brain tumor treatment at subsidized costs, though the waiting time may be longer.
